In many states, you’re required to carry several of these vehicle coverages—most frequently liability insurance. In some cases, if you don’t want some of these insurance coverages on your policy, you may be able to reject them in writing.

Property damage liability covers repair costs for damage you cause to another person’s vehicle or property in a covered accident.
Uninsured motorist coverage may help pay for injuries—or, in some states, property damage—if you’re hit by a driver with no insurance, or if it’s a hit-and-run.
If it’s available in your state, underinsured motorist coverage may help pay for medical expenses and, in some states, property damage if you’re hit by a driver with insufficient coverage.
Collision auto coverage can help pay for the damage to your vehicle after it hits another vehicle—no matter who’s at fault in a covered accident.
Sometimes referred to as “other than collision,” comprehensive insurance coverage may help pay for damage to your vehicle from things like fire, theft, vandalism, hail, and falling objects.
These coverages may not be available in all states. If they’re available in your state, they may be required or optional—review your state’s auto insurance requirements and discuss your options with your agent.
In a covered accident, PIP coverage pays for reasonable and necessary medical expenses for injuries to the driver and any passenger in your vehicle, regardless of who is at fault in the accident. In addition, there may be coverage available for lost wages, lost services and funeral expenses. Not allowed in all states.
Medical bills can add up after an accident. Medical Payments insurance coverage could pay for reasonable and necessary medical expenses for the driver and passengers in your vehicle. It also covers funeral expenses. This coverage applies no matter who’s at fault in a covered accident.

The good news is your car is being repaired due to a covered loss. The bad? You have no way to get to work. Rental reimbursement coverage could give you money towards a rental to keep your life moving.
If you’re buying or leasing a vehicle, the lender may require you to carry specific coverages. Insurance options available in your state—like car loan protection or lienholder deductible—may offer additional coverage. These options can help if your car is totaled before it’s paid off, or if you need a lower deductible and still want to save money.
You may have added a few special touches to your car, but what happens if they get wrecked in a crash? Special equipment insurance coverage could help pay for the customizations you’ve made. Just understand, certain restrictions may apply.
Our roadside assistance coverage offers 24/7 service for a range of issues you can experience while driving, including a dead battery, flat tire, breakdown, running out of gas, and even locking your keys in your car.
